Hato Viejo is a comunidad located in Ciales Municipio, Puerto Rico . Unfortunately, the data for this location is currently limited or unavailable.

The average household income in Hato Viejo is $28,422 with a poverty rate of 52.58%. The median age in Hato Viejo is 35 years: 29.6 years for males, and 38.6 years for females.

Economics and Income Statistics

Hato Viejo's average per capita income is $24,628. Household income levels show a median of $30,197. The poverty rate stands at 52.58%.

Families: A family includes the owner or renter of the home along with everyone related to them - whether through birth, marriage, or adoption. This includes relatives like spouses, children, parents, siblings, grandparents, and any other family members.
Households: A household includes all the people who occupy a housing unit (such as a house or apartment) as their usual place of residence.
Non Families: A nonfamily household is either someone living alone or when the owner/renter lives with people they aren't related to, like roommates.
